Understanding Galvanized Steel Grating
Galvanized steel grating is a type of steel grating that has been coated with a layer of zinc to prevent corrosion. This coating provides additional protection against rust and enhances the durability of the grating, making it ideal for high-traffic areas such as railway stations. The process of galvanization involves applying a zinc coating to the steel, which acts as a barrier against moisture and other corrosive elements.
Benefits of Galvanized Steel Grating
1. Durability: Galvanized steel grating is highly durable and can withstand heavy loads and extreme weather conditions. This makes it an excellent choice for railway stations, which experience constant foot traffic and varying environmental conditions.
2. Corrosion Resistance: The zinc coating provides excellent corrosion resistance, ensuring that the grating remains in excellent condition for longer periods. This is particularly important in railway stations, where the grating is exposed to moisture, chemicals, and other corrosive substances.
3. Safety: Galvanized steel grating is designed with safety in mind. The open grid structure allows for easy drainage, reducing the risk of slipping and falling. Additionally, the grating can be installed with anti-slip surfaces to further enhance safety.
4. Aesthetic Appeal: Galvanized steel grating offers a clean and modern look, which can enhance the aesthetic appeal of railway stations. The uniform grid pattern provides a visually pleasing appearance while maintaining functionality.
5. Cost-Effectiveness: Despite its numerous benefits, galvanized steel grating is a cost-effective solution for railway station construction. Its longevity reduces the need for frequent repairs and replacements, resulting in long-term savings.
Applications of Galvanized Steel Grating in Railway Stations
Galvanized steel grating is used in various applications within railway stations, each contributing to the overall functionality and safety of the facility.
1. Platforms and Walkways
One of the most common applications of galvanized steel grating in railway stations is for platforms and walkways. The grating provides a sturdy and safe surface for passengers to walk on, while also allowing for proper drainage and ventilation.
2. Ramps and Stairs
Galvanized steel grating is also used for constructing ramps and stairs in railway stations. Its lightweight yet durable nature makes it an ideal choice for creating accessible routes for passengers.
3. Drainage Systems
The open grid structure of galvanized steel grating makes it an excellent material for drainage systems in railway stations. It allows water to flow through while preventing debris from entering, ensuring that the station remains dry and safe.
4. Security Barriers
Galvanized steel grating is used to create security barriers in railway stations, helping to control access and maintain safety. The grating is strong enough to prevent unauthorized access while still allowing for visibility and ventilation.
5. Roofing and Canopies
The grating is also used for roofing and canopies in railway stations, providing a durable and weather-resistant surface. This helps to protect passengers from the elements while maintaining an open and airy atmosphere.
